Problems solved by technology

Since it is necessary to provide a plurality of communication lines, there is a problem that the weight of the communication lines increases and the weight of the vehicle body increases
[0007] The wiring device in a vehicle described in JP-A-11-266251 has a problem that it cannot be applied to current automobiles because the main cable is composed of a leaky cable, so it needs to replace the network used in the current automobile and relay the leaky cable.
In addition, there is a problem that the weight of the vehicle body increases due to newly laying leaky cables in the case of using the current network
In addition, the radio and TV are received in the vehicle, but the situation of being a noise source is not considered
[0008] In addition, the in-vehicle communication system described in JP-A-9-55986 has the problem that it cannot be applied to current vehicles because it needs to replace the network used in current vehicles with a new dedicated communication cable.
In addition, there is a problem of increased body weight due to the re-laying of cables with the current network
[0009] In addition, although the in-vehicle LAN system described in JP-A-2003-116187 and the vehicle communication system described in JP-A-2003-318925 use power line transmission, they do not consider preventing interference with radios and televisions. Signal attenuation is taken into account

Abstract

It is possible to provide a vehicle and an in-vehicle communication control device capable of performing control having preferable response even under an environment where notch attenuation and various noises are superposed in a wired communication by using a battery line. The in-vehicle communication control device includes: a controller for inputting operation amounts detected by respective sensors arranged in a plurality of operation devices arranged in a vehicle chamber for detecting operation amounts of the operation devices; a communication device connected to the controller and the battery line for outputting a control signal as a carrier of different frequency for each type of the operation devices to the battery line; a second communication device connected to the battery line and passing the carrier of the frequency band of each of the operation devices; and a second controller connected to the second communication device and controlling the control device corresponding to the operation devices.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to an automobile using a battery wire as a communication line and a communication and control device in the automobile. Background technique [0002] In recent years, equipment using inverters in automobiles has become more and more popular. Large noise is generated due to the switching operation of the inverter, which is a device that controls a large current. Since these noises or electromagnetic waves are superimposed on the signal of the communication cable, the communication performance is degraded. In addition, when there is a branch point or a joint in the communication cable, or when the end is open, a sharp signal attenuation called notch attenuation may occur at a specific frequency due to reflection due to impedance mismatch.
